Collectors is the leading creator of innovative technology that provides value-added services for collectors worldwide. We grade, authenticate, vault, and sell millions of record-setting collectibles, all while modernizing and digitalizing the process to further our mission of helping collectors pursue their passions. We’re always on the lookout for talented people to join our growing team.

Our services span collectible trading cards, autographs, comic books, coins, video games, event tickets, and memorabilia. Our subsidiaries include PSA, PCGS, Beckett, SGC, and Card Ladder.

Since our founding in 1986, we have graded and authenticated millions of items. We employ more than 3000 people across our headquarters in Santa Ana, California and offices in New Jersey, Texas, Florida, Japan, Shanghai, Hong Kong, Canada, Mexico, Germany, the UK, and France.

About Collectors

Collectors is the leading creator of innovative technology that provides value-added services for collectors worldwide. We authenticate, grade, vault, and sell millions of record-setting collectibles, all while modernizing and digitalizing the process to further our mission of helping collectors pursue their passions. We’re always on the lookout for talented people to join our growing team.

Our services span collectible coins, trading cards, video games, event tickets, autographs, comics, magazines, and memorabilia, and our subsidiaries include:

𝗣𝗦𝗔: The global leader in authentication and grading for trading cards, autographs, memorabilia, and other collectible categories.

𝗣𝗦𝗔 𝗩𝗮𝘂𝗹𝘁: A secure, climate-controlled solution for storing, managing, and selling collectibles. Fully integrated with eBay and other top marketplaces to make transactions fast, easy, and efficient.

𝗣𝗖𝗚𝗦: The premier authority in numismatic certification, ensuring the authenticity and preservation of coins and banknotes.

𝗖𝗼𝗹𝗹𝗲𝗰𝘁𝗼𝗿𝘀 𝗙𝗶𝗻𝗮𝗻𝗰𝗶𝗮𝗹 𝗦𝗼𝗹𝘂𝘁𝗶𝗼𝗻𝘀: Asset-backed financial solutions that empower collectors to leverage their holdings and capitalize on new opportunities.

𝗦𝗚𝗖: A distinguished name in trading card authentication and grading, known for its commitment to fast, reliable service at competitive pricing.

𝗖𝗮𝗿𝗱 𝗟𝗮𝗱𝗱𝗲𝗿: An advanced analytics platform providing real-time collectibles market insights, historical data, and enterprise solutions.
